Piloerection!: Goose bumps are created when tiny muscles at the base of each hair contract and pull the hair erect. It is triggered by the sympathetic nervous system, part of the fight-or-flight/stress response system. It occurs more easily (under both good or bad stress) in some individuals than others. Learning effective stress management techniques might lessen if desired. Don't know what CNSS is/are.

Piloerection: Goose bumps are the result of involuntary erection or bristling of hairs due to contraction of tiny muscles that elevate the hair follicles above the rest of the skin. They are usually triggered by cold, shock, fright or stimulants. So I searched the web and acronymfinder.com and found no reference to any drug or supplement under the acronym CNSS.
